Following the suggestion in Herbert's Tips and Tricks page, I tried
running 'pdfimage' on a one-page pdf which is a map (probably originally
drawn in AutoCAD). I ended up with several hundred little files of the
format '-xxx.pbm'. 'pdfimage' is probably extracting each layer as a
separate file. Yuck!

  What I would like -- if it can be done -- is to end up with a greyscale
version of this location map that I can then bring into a figure float in my
book.

  Since extracting "the" image didn't work, should I try pdf2ps, then
ps2eps (after converting to greyscale with ImageMagick)? What's the most
efficient approach that might result in a high-quality graphic? I'd prefer
to not have to recreate the map locally.
